Вопросы по теме 'attributerouting'

Проблема соответствия URL WebAPI
Я реализовал AttributeRouting и WebApi в своем веб-проекте. И я пытаюсь направить URL-адрес, например http://localhost/apis/test?adminId=yyy , в GetSomeInfo действие. Но я столкнулся с некоторыми проблемами, URL-адреса http://localhost/apis/test...
762 просмотров
schedule 03.02.2024

необычное поведение с маршрутизацией атрибутов
Я работаю с атрибутивной маршрутизацией и считаю ее превосходной. В частности, тот факт, что я могу локализовать свои маршруты в различных культурах. Я столкнулся с проблемой, которая возникает нерегулярно - это происходит иногда, а не другие, и я...
361 просмотров

Как указать маршрут с помощью строки запроса?
Я пытаюсь добавить AttributeRouting в свой проект WebAPI. На одном контроллере у меня в настоящее время определены три метода GET: [GET("dictionaries")] public IEnumerable<Dictionary> Get() [GET("dictionaries/{id}")] public Dictionary...
3107 просмотров

Ограничить маршруты атрибутов определенными HTTP-командами
С библиотекой AttributeRouting я могу ограничить маршрут определенным глаголом: [Route("customers", HttpVerbs.Post)] В MVC 5 встроен AttributeRouting, но нет перегрузки, принимающей HttpVerbs. Как в этом случае ограничить маршрут POST?
726 просмотров
schedule 19.03.2023

(ASP MVC4) Маршрутизация атрибутов/RedirectToRoute
Мне нужна небольшая помощь в том, чего я пытаюсь достичь. Я делаю приложение ASP MVC и не могу правильно проложить маршруты. Я использую маршрутизацию атрибутов пакета nuget (которая теперь по умолчанию используется в MVC5). Сначала у меня не...
907 просмотров

Маршрутизация атрибутов не работает со словарями
Будучи новичком в маршрутизации атрибутов, я хотел бы попросить помощи, чтобы это заработало. Этот тест представляет собой простое динамическое средство просмотра таблиц БД: учитывая имя таблицы (или сохраненное имя запроса или что-то еще) и,...
1124 просмотров

Неоднозначные маршруты с маршрутизацией атрибутов MVC5
У меня проблема с неоднозначными маршрутами при использовании маршрутизации по атрибутам. Проблемы проистекают из (я считаю) использования переменных параметров в корне наших маршрутов. Что меня беспокоит, так это то, что буквальные параметры,...
4485 просмотров
schedule 19.04.2022

Маршрутизация на основе атрибутов веб-API в виртуальном каталоге
У меня возникла проблема с вызовом веб-API из приложения angular/hotowel, где контроллер веб-API использует маршрутизацию на основе атрибутов. В настоящее время мне интересно, мешает ли angular, но, честно говоря, я понятия не имею, как это...
668 просмотров

Маршрутизация Asp.Net MVC не работает должным образом в 5.1
Мне нужно добавить культуру в URL-адрес для поддержки локализации в моем приложении asp.net mvc с URL-адресами типа: sample.com/ en /about sample.com/ ru /product/2342 Недавно я обновил свое приложение с MVC 5.0 до 5.1, но маршрутизация не...
983 просмотров

Путь ASP.NET MVC с расширением файла
В ASP.NET MVC5 с использованием маршрутизации на основе атрибутов я хочу обрабатывать URL-адреса с расширениями файлов, например ~/javascript/security.js Вот пример метода действия контроллера: [Route("javascript/security.js")]...
1449 просмотров

Маршрутизация атрибутов WebApi - простейший маршрут не работает
У меня есть очень простой контроллер WebApi, как показано ниже, который использует маршрутизацию атрибутов. public class ValueController : ApiController { //This route returns a 404 [Route("api/v1/values")] public Value GetValue()...
195 просмотров
schedule 22.01.2023

web api — маршрутизация атрибутов обработчика сообщений
Кто-нибудь знает, может ли обработчик сообщений работать одновременно с маршрутизацией атрибутов в Web API 2.x? У меня есть собственный обработчик сообщений для работы с использованием обычной маршрутизации, а после добавления маршрутизации атрибутов...
1361 просмотров

Как я могу использовать маршруты на основе атрибутов MVC5 с точкой / периодом в них?
В основном у меня есть готовое приложение MVC 5.2 с включенными маршрутами на основе атрибутов (вызов routes.MapMvcAttributeRoutes(); из предоставленного метода RouteConfig.RegisterRoutes(RouteCollection routes) ). Следующее находится в...
1870 просмотров

Конфигурация ASP MVP НЕ соглашение
Я понимаю многие преимущества соглашения по сравнению с конфигурационным подходом ASP MVC. Тем не менее, я хотел бы попытаться создать сайт на основе ASP MVC, используя подход, основанный на конфигурации, и с атрибутами маршрута. По сути, я хотел...
53 просмотров

Маршрутизация атрибутов WebApi для URL-адресов с *.js
Хорошо, это не такой смешной конец... Я пытаюсь эмулировать службу на основе RoR в .Net WebAPI. Предполагается, что реализация службы Ruby возвращает документ JSON из URL-адреса: http://myserver/api/assessments/{id}.js Обратите внимание...
773 просмотров

Пользовательская (атрибутная) маршрутизация MVC с необязательным параметром не работает
Мой контроллер выглядит так: [HttpGet] [Route("{brand}/{category}/{subcategory?}/{productid:int:min(9000)}", Name="ProductDetails")] public ActionResult Details(int productid) { //...} Я также пробовал без вопросительного знака в конце...
199 просмотров
schedule 01.02.2023

Маршрутизация атрибутов веб-API ASP.NET: RoutePrefix с параметром Route
Возможно ли в ASP.NET иметь атрибут RoutePrefix в ApiController, который содержит параметр маршрута? [RoutePrefix("api/parent/{pid}/child")] public class ChildController : ApiController { [Route("")] public HttpResponseMessage Get(object...
3371 просмотров
schedule 12.02.2023

Как вы устанавливаете маршрут по умолчанию в MVC6 при использовании атрибутов?
В MVC5 вы можете установить маршрут по умолчанию, используя следующий атрибут на контроллере? [Маршрут("{action=index}")] Что эквивалентно этому в MVC6? Обновить Это код, который у меня был в MVC5 [Route("{action=index}")]...
1219 просмотров

RouteAttribute отсутствует
Я использую Microsoft ASP.NET Web API 2.2 в веб-приложении. Контроллер выглядит так: public class EventsController: ApiController { [HttpGet] [Route("GetAllActivities")] public IEnumerable<IActivity> GetEvents() { /* stuff */...
3291 просмотров

Маршрутизация атрибутов веб-API Asp.net не работает с .
Атрибутная маршрутизация с "." не работает в моем проекте веб-API Образец URL-адреса, который не работает http://localhost:8082/image/TestImage.jpg [RoutePrefix("image")] public class TestController : ApiController {...
44 просмотров